The Arizona Republic, Phoenix, Arizona, Wednesday September 14, 1960, Page 37
May J. Sanderson
Funeral services for Mrs. May J. (Jimmie May) Sanderson, 75, who died yesterday at her home 3445 W. Broadway, will be at 10 a.m. Friday in the Paradise Chapel and Funeral Home, 3934 E. Indian School.
Burial will be in Memory Lawn Memorial Park.
Friends may call at the funeral home from 6 p.m. today until service time.
A native of Tennessee, Mrs. Sanderson came to Phoenix two years ago from Brownwood, Tex.
She is survived by two sons, V. O. of Scottdale and Melvin of Napoa, Calif., and three daughters, Mrs. Allie McNabb of Salinas, Calif., and Mrs. Ollie Templin in Texas, and Mrs. Dorothy Carden of Phoenix. Also surviving are two sisters out of state, 13 grandchildren and 21 great-grandchildren.
